λογγ-άσια [α^], τά,
A.stones with holes in them, through which mooringcables were passed, Hsch., Phot. s.v. λογγάζειν:—sg. λογγα^σίη , Hsch.:—also λογγῶνες , οἱ, Syracusan acc. to EM569.42, cf. Suid.
